Output babda0cf8cec22cb840ed91eae26551cdbcbb11d2affe696c5bc6594d7e673f4:3

value
977612
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 73f0655bd4d1a31a6491b387f3ba73c6d3ae03f1587208c06d0ad5f4de1dbc66
address
tb1pw0cx2k756x335ey3kwrl8wnncmf6uql3tpeq3srdpt2lfhsah3nqe5t27f
transaction
babda0cf8cec22cb840ed91eae26551cdbcbb11d2affe696c5bc6594d7e673f4
confirmations
77894
spent
true